Abstract: The term "Information Technology" (now generally abbreviated to IT) is a comparatively recent addition to the English language. It has been defined in many different ways. The most suitable definition for our purposes is: "Information Technology is concerned with systems for the creation, acquisition, processing, storage, retrieval, selection, transformation, dissemination and use of vocal, pictorial, textual and numerical information. Current systems typically utilize a microelectronics- based combination of computing and telecommunications."
